You don't need a law degree to understand your rights—just this book.
Whether you're signing a lease, responding to a court summons, or simply want to know what the law says, Law 101 (2nd Edition) is your essential plain-English guide to America's legal system. Written by seasoned attorney Brien A. Roche with John and Sean Roche, this trusted reference demystifies civil and criminal law, contracts, torts, constitutional rights, and more—making it easy for anyone to grasp core legal concepts.
Gain confidence, protect your rights, and act with clarity in everyday legal situations.
Perfect for students, professionals, and curious readers, this updated edition covers:
Civil and criminal law, constitutional rights, and contract essentials
Real-world examples that show how laws apply to daily life
Fast, Q&A-style structure to quickly answer common legal questions
Practical guidance on juries, lawsuits, tenant issues, and self-representation
Expanded topics on Internet law, privacy, and dispute resolution
Used in classrooms and praised by readers as "layperson-friendly" and "invaluable," Law 101 equips you to make smarter decisions and advocate for yourself with confidence.
